Why Choose a Gasoline Lawn Mower?

Gasoline lawn mowers are known for their powerful engines, which make them ideal for cutting thick grass and tackling large areas. Unlike electric mowers, they don’t require a power cord or frequent recharging, giving you the freedom to mow without restrictions. Here are some key advantages:

  • Powerful Performance: Gas mowers can handle tough grass and uneven terrain with ease.
  • No Cord Hassles: Unlike electric mowers, you won’t be limited by cords or battery life.
  • Longevity: With proper maintenance, gas mowers can last for many years.
  • Versatility: Many models come with additional features like mulching and bagging options.

Types of Gasoline Lawn Mowers

Gasoline lawn mowers come in several types, each designed for specific needs. Here’s a breakdown of the most common options:

1. Push Gas Mowers

Push mowers are the most basic type, requiring manual effort to move them across the lawn. They are ideal for small to medium-sized yards and are often more affordable than other types.

2. Self-Propelled Gas Mowers

Self-propelled mowers have a drive system that moves the mower forward, reducing the effort required by the user. These are perfect for larger lawns or areas with slopes.

3. Riding Gas Mowers

Riding mowers are designed for large properties, allowing you to sit and drive while mowing. They save time and effort, making them a favorite among professionals.

Maintenance Tips for Gasoline Lawn Mowers

Proper maintenance is key to keeping your gas mower running smoothly. Follow these tips to ensure longevity and peak performance:

  • Change the Oil Regularly: Just like a car, your mower’s engine needs fresh oil to function properly.
  • Clean or Replace the Air Filter: A dirty air filter can reduce engine efficiency.
  • Sharpen the Blades: Dull blades tear grass instead of cutting it, leading to an unhealthy lawn.
  • Use Fresh Gasoline: Stale gas can cause engine problems. Always use fresh fuel.
